| Identify strong electrolytes. A) NaOH, Mg (OH) 2, NH4OH B) H2SO3, H2S, KOH C) Ba (OH) 2, HMnO4, Ba (NO3) 2 D) Al (OH) 3, H2CO3, KOH
Strong electrolytes are strong acids, alkalis, soluble salts. Consider the answer options:
A) NaOH – alkali (strong electrolyte), Mg (OH) 2, NH4OH – bases (weak electrolytes)
B) H2SO3 and H2S – weak and medium-strength acids (weak electrolytes), KOH – alkali (strong electrolyte)
B) Ba (OH) 2 – alkali, HMnO4 – strong acid, Ba (NO3) 2 – soluble salt (strong electrolytes)
D) Al (OH) 3 – base, H2CO3 – weak acid (weak electrolytes), KOH – alkali (strong electrolyte)
